Undo’s €31M raise gives AI coding tools more runtime context

Undo’s €31 million raise highlights a shift in AI-assisted software engineering from writing code faster to understanding how code behaves when it runs.

AI coding is moving beyond autocomplete. Undo’s funding points to the next developer-tools layer: giving AI systems the runtime context they need to understand what software actually does.

What happened

Undo raised €31 million to support software engineering tooling that brings runtime context into AI-assisted development. The company is focused on helping teams understand how code behaves during execution, not just how it looks in a repository.

Why it matters

AI coding tools can generate code quickly, but debugging and reliability still depend on understanding real behaviour. Runtime context can help developers and AI assistants trace issues, explain failures and make safer changes.

The bigger picture

Developer Tools are shifting from code generation toward software understanding. As AI becomes part of engineering workflows, tools that improve context, debugging and reliability may become essential infrastructure.
